The transcript features a discussion about working with director Christopher Nolan, focusing on his unique scriptwriting and storytelling style. The speaker shares insights into the personal connection felt in Nolan's films and the challenges of understanding his complex scripts. The conversation also touches on future projects and contractual obligations related to the Batman series.
